CALC HELP PLEASEEvaluate ∫(0 to 3) xf(x2)dx, if f is continuous and ∫(0 to 9) f(x)dx=4.?

I know this is kind of basic but I took this class last semester and cant remember. thanks

2 Answers

Start off by letting:u = x^2 ==> du = 2x dx. Then. changing the bounds:Lower bound: x = 0 ==> u = 0^2 = 0Upper bound: x = 3 ==> u = 3^2 = 9. So, we have:∫ x*f(x^2) dx (from x=0 to 3)= 1/2 ∫ f(x^2) (2x dx) (from x=0 to 3)= 1/2 ∫ f(u) du (from u=0 to 9), by applying substitutions= 1/2 ∫ f(x) dx (from x=0 to 9), since x and u are both dummy variables= (1/2)(4), since ∫ f(x) dx (from x=0 to 9) = 4= 2.I hope this helps!...
